The best Side of Conditional operator or Ternary Operator



In this particular chapter, you learned about arithmetic operators in C#. You furthermore may uncovered tips on how to use arithmetic operator in method.

This area covers the list of subject areas for C# programming illustrations. These C# examples cover a variety of programming regions in Personal computer Science. Each case in point method consists of the description of This system, C# code together with output of This system.

You should not nest them. Avoid using them as elements of a lot more intricate expressions. Use parentheses liberally, particularly when They are Component of a far more elaborate expression.

C# supports strongly typed implicit variable declarations Using the key word var, and implicitly typed arrays Using the key word new[] followed by a group initializer.

four @Craig , I concur, but It is also valuable to learn what will occur when there are no parentheses. In serious code, I far too would are likely to insert specific parens.

This site uses cookies for analytics, personalized content material and ads. By continuing to browse this site, you agree to this use. Find out more

In the initial A part of the C# Fundamentals tutorial, we established a console software and outputted textual content using the Console.WriteLine command. This may also be utilized to output numeric facts. One example is:

This Site makes use of cookies. By using the site you settle for the cookie plan.This concept is for compliance With all the UK ICO law.

Because of an unlucky style and design of your language grammar, the conditional operator in PHP is left associative in contrast to other languages, Consequently specified a value of T for arg, the PHP code in the following illustration would generate the worth horse instead of teach as a single could hope:[11]

When x is of variety int or website prolonged, the lower-purchase bits of x are discarded, the remaining bits are shifted ideal, along with the high-buy empty little bit positions are set to zero if x is non-adverse and set to 1 if x is negative.

When x is of variety uint or ulong, the very low-get bits of x are discarded, the remaining bits are shifted right, and also the large-purchase empty little bit positions are established to zero.

, prevent working with constraints and use dynamic to briefly keep the generic variable then make the idea (by way of duck typing) that it has the relevant operators:

C# programming is a great deal determined by C and C++ programming languages, so if you have a primary understanding of C or C++ programming, then Will probably be entertaining to master C#.

The results of bitwise Procedure on signed integers is implementation-outlined according to the ANSI C conventional. For that Microsoft C compiler, bitwise operations on signed integers perform the same as bitwise operations on unsigned integers. One example is, -16 & 99 is usually expressed in binary as

Leave a Reply

Your email address will not be published. Required fields are marked *